The Struggles of a Butterfly

An honest man lived with his wife who loved butterflies and two children in a village in Cambodia. Every day the man went to a park near his house. One day, while going about his routine, he spotted a butterfly cocoon with only a small opening, and he grew excited as he watched it intently. A while later the butterfly began to struggle more and more, a moment that echoes the themes in Inspirational Quotes About Struggle. The man decided to help the butterfly get out of the cocoon, believing it had been hours and the insect was still struggling.

He decides to grab a pair of scissors and cuts the cocoon’s remaining fabric, and the butterfly slips free and drops to the ground. He notices the butterfly has bruises and a damaged wing; he feels relief for having helped it, yet sadness that it cannot fly, a consequence some stories like Story On Helping Others warn against.

When he returns home, the man shares the tale with his wife. She, who also had an interest in butterflies, bluntly replies that he should have never thought of helping the butterfly, a sentiment echoed in the Story of a Frog.

Yet the man did not realize that the cocoon’s constriction and the butterfly’s struggle to squeeze through the narrow opening were part of a natural process God designed to push fluid into the wings, preparing it for flight once free from the cocoon.

As a result of his actions, the butterfly is unable to fly for the rest of its life.

Moral of the Story

When we go through struggle, it can develop our strengths; without challenge, we may never achieve our goals. Sometimes you must allow the struggle to help you develop resilience and prepare you to overcome obstacles, a lesson echoed in Inspirational Quotes About Struggle.
